What Will You Learn From An Affiliate Marketing Course?

An affiliate marketing course can teach you a wide range of skills and strategies to help you succeed in the industry.

Here are some of the key things you can learn:

  • Niche Selection: How to research and identify profitable niches for your affiliate business.
  • Website Building: The fundamentals of setting up a website, from domain registration to website architecture and design.
  • Content Creation: Techniques for creating high-quality, engaging content that resonates with your target audience.
  • Keyword Research: Strategies for finding the right keywords to target and optimize your content for search engines.
  • SEO (Search Engine Optimization): Learn how to optimize your website and content for better search engine rankings and visibility.
  • Link Building: Tactics for building high-quality backlinks to your website to improve its authority and credibility.
  • Monetization: Strategies for effectively monetizing your website through affiliate programs, display ads, and other revenue streams.
  • Email Marketing: The art of building an email list and using email campaigns to drive sales and engagement.
  • Analytics and Tracking: How to use various tools and metrics to measure the performance of your affiliate marketing efforts.
  • Mindset and Motivation: Tips and techniques for staying motivated and overcoming the challenges of building an affiliate business.
